Then move to DataOps, CI/CD, monitoring, security, governance, and architecture design. Practice small projects during the last two weeks. Common Mistakes to Avoid Many learners focus only on tools. That is not enough for a DataOps Architect. Avoid these mistakes: Learning tools without understanding architecture Ignoring data quality Not using version control Missing monitoring and alerting Ignoring governance and security Not planning for failures Forgetting cloud cost control Building pipelines without ownership Treating data pipelines like simple scripts A good DataOps Architect thinks about reliability, scale, governance, and business trust. Choose Your Path DevOps Path DevOps engineers can move into DataOps by applying CI/CD, automation, monitoring, and release management to data pipelines. DevSecOps Path DevSecOps professionals can focus on data security, compliance, access control, audit logs, and secure pipeline delivery. SRE Path SRE professionals can use reliability engineering, monitoring, incident response, and SLA thinking to improve data platform stability. AIOps/MLOps Path AIOps and MLOps professionals can use DataOps to build strong data foundations for AI, ML, and automation systems. DataOps Path Data engineers and DataOps engineers can use CDOA to grow into architecture roles and design enterprise-level platforms. FinOps Path FinOps professionals can use DataOps knowledge to control cloud data platform costs and improve resource usage.
